Zimbabwe's Dingy Trains Mirror Economic Decline

Dark, dirty and slow, Zimbabwe's trains, like much else in the impoverished southern African country, have seen better days. Once the preferred mode of transport for most Zimbabweans, the state-run rail service mirrors the decline in the country's economic fortunes during the last two decades under the leadership of former President Robert Mugabe.
